车牌识别系统的关键技术
车牌识别系统的关键技术主要包括三个方面:车牌定位、字符分割和字符识别。
车牌定位技术:
图像预处理:包括灰度化、去噪、增强对比度等步骤,通常使用中值滤波去除椒盐噪声
边缘检测:常用Sobel算子、Canny算子等检测车牌边界
颜色特征提取:基于HSV和RGB双重颜色模型识别蓝白像素点
形态学处理:通过闭运算和开运算定位车牌区域
倾斜校正:使用Hough变换或最小二乘法修正拍摄角度导致的图像倾斜
字符分割技术:
二值化处理:将车牌图像转换为黑白两色,常用Otsu阈值法
投影法:利用水平和垂直投影分割字符
连通域分析:基于字符连通域宽高检测和先验知识解决字符粘连问题
多层次累加投影:通过粗分割、二次分割和细分割三个阶段逐步精确定位
字符识别技术:
特征提取:使用粗网格化的统计和结构特征相结合的方法
机器学习算法:支持向量机(SVM)、神经网络或深度学习模型
模板匹配:与预先训练的模板库比对识别字符
层次分类器:针对汉字、字母和数字分别设计识别器,如汉字识别采用模板匹配粗分类器、结构笔画数粗分类器和结构信息细分类器组合
这些技术的有效组合使车牌识别系统能够适应不同光照条件、拍摄角度和车辆速度,在高速公路、停车场、电子警察等场景中实现高效准确的车辆身份识别。
